Job summary

Sanford Health in Sioux Falls is seeking a Vascular Interventional Radiographer Technologist to perform diagnostic and interventional radiographic procedures with emphasis on image quality and patient safety. The role requires ARRT registration, VI/CI certifications within 24 months, and BLS certification within six weeks of employment.

Applicants should have AMA-approved radiologic technology training and relevant experience.

## Vascular Interventional Radiographer TechnologistApply: SD, Sioux Falls: Full time: Posted Today: R-0274539**Sanford Health, the largest rural health system in the United States, is dedicated to transforming the health care experience and providing access to world-class health care in America’s heartland.****Work Shift:**Day (United States of America)**Scheduled Weekly Hours:**40**Compensation:****Union Position:**No**Department Details****Summary**Provides high quality images, to include sophisticate special procedures, through the operation of specialized equipment which ensures optimum clarity for physician diagnosis and minimum discomfort and radiation exposure to patients. Thoroughly understands the operation of the interventional equipment and supplies, diagnostic radiographic principles, including film/imaging processing, quality control, and radiation protection.**Job Description**Works to minimize the risk and duration of recovery to patients, imitating life support measures as necessary. Adheres to the Safety and Infection Control Policies established by Sanford Health. Works to develop an understanding of the patient's physical and emotional status, while practicing sensitivity and patient confidentiality at all times. Works well with all age groups.Possesses an extensive knowledge of anatomy, physiology, disease processes, and medical terminology. Familiar with operative terms and pharmacology. Knowledge of billing and coding of procedures. Ability to adapt and facilitate change. Performs on a level not requiring constant supervision and must exercise professional judgment in the performance of highly specialized procedures.Ability to work a flexible schedule and take after hour call when needed. Ability to provide knowledge and be responsible for scheduling and performing diagnostic and interventional procedures in designated units. Observes, evaluates, and participates in the educational processes of the Radiologic Technology student.**Qualifications**Satisfactory completion of formal radiologic technology training in an American Medical Association (AMA) approved school is required. Minimum of one year experience as a staff radiologic technologist preferred. Registration through the American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) is required.Due to Diagnostic Imaging Center of Excellence (DICO) Accreditation, if working in North Dakota (ND) and performing medical imaging, interventional radiology, or radiation therapy procedures, licensure through the North Dakota Medical Imaging and Radiation Therapy (NDMIRT) Board is required.If working in South Dakota (SD) and responsibilities performed within interventional radiology, employees are encouraged to obtain and maintain a Vascular Interventional Technology (VI) certification within 24 months of hire into position.Additionally, if responsibilities performed within the Cardiac Cath Lab, employees are encouraged to obtain and maintain a Cardiovascular Interventional Radiography (CI) certification within 24 months of hire into position.Basic Life Support (BLS) required within six weeks of employment and re-certification as necessary required.**Sanford is an EEO/AA Employer M/F/Disability/Vet.****If you are an individual with a disability and would like to request an accommodation for help with your online application, please call 1-877-949-5678 or send an email to talent@sanfordhealth.org.**
